Broken Seals

The majority of modern windows are double-paned, and are filled with air or gas (typically Krypton or argon) between the panes prior being sealed in factory. Gases aid in keeping heat inside during the winter, and outside during the summer. This makes them an energy-efficient choice. Over time, seals may fail. When the seal is broken, humidity begins to leak into the gaps between the glass panes. This can result in a cloudy appearance and less insulation. Your home will not be as warm or cozy.

The most frequent reason for the failure of a seal on windows is the natural expansion and contraction that occurs within the frame. The window is exposed to different temperatures and levels of humidity. They can expand or contract in response. The cycle of expansion and contraction can eventually cause the seal to crack.

Seals can also be damaged due to other factors. Seals are more likely to break on older windows that have been exposed to the elements over and over. Natural house settlement can also cause the framing of your windows to shift, placing additional pressure on seals.

A broken window seal can lead to a host of other problems if unfixed. If the seals are damaged in your home, water can leak through, leading to the growth of mold and a decline in the quality of indoor air. It can also lead to water damage to your home, and a decrease in energy efficiency. It is essential to contact an expert as soon as you spot any indication of a broken seal, such as fogging or drafts. Otherwise, you might end up with hefty heating and cooling bills, an uncomfortable living space, and lots of costly repairs in the future.

Double-glazed windows can become misty in the event that the seal that seals out moisture begins to wear down. This is especially prevalent in regions of the UK that experience wet winters and high humidity levels. Once the seal breaks down it can allow moisture to enter into the gaps between the glass panes and cause them to turn misty.

There are many ways to fix a window that has become misty. One way to fix a misty window is to thoroughly clean it. You can also use an agent to defog the windows. This involves drilling a small hole in the window, and spraying a dry agent into the void. It is essential to know that this method may not be effective in all situations and could be costly.

The third option for fixing the misty double-glazed windows near me is to replace the glass pane alone. If the frame of the window and the other components of the window are in good shape it is a cost-effective solution. This method is less invasive and costly than replacing the entire window. It is also able to be completed in a short time. It is nevertheless important to check with a glazier what is included in the price quoted to ensure that there are no hidden costs.

Faulty Gaskets

Many homeowners are faced with condensation when using double glazing. It happens when there is an opening of the seal that allows moisture to get in between the glass panes. The moisture turns into condensation, which is visible inside the window and makes it look dirty. Condensation may also affect the appearance of your home and can be a problem if you're trying to sell it. There are steps you can take to fix the issue and avoid it from repeating itself in the future.

The majority of modern double-glazed windows feature a'spacer bar' between the two glass panels of the window. This spacer bar is filled with a gas, most commonly argon or xenon, which helps keep cold air from your home and the warm air inside. It also acts as sound barrier between your home and the outside. The gap between the two glass panes is typically extremely tight, however when it's leaking in any way then this can cause problems with condensation and moisture in the double glazing.

Faulty seals can cause the spacer bars to deform and create gaps between the windows. This can result in water getting trapped within the gap causing mist to form on the windows. This is a major issue that cannot be solved by simply replacing the window seals. It will most likely require the glass panel to be replaced.

If you're facing a double glazing problem the best thing you can do is contact a local window expert. They can give you an estimate of the cost to fix the problem and whether they are willing to do it, especially in the event that the issue occurred after their installation.

It is worth checking whether the business offers a warranty on their work. They might be able to address any issues that arise after having installed new windows. Some have a standard warranty of either 10 or 20 years, and others offer a lifetime warranty. Check what is covered by the warranty. Some may only cover certain hardware like hinges or handles while others include all aspects of the installation and the entire window.

If you're covered under a warranty, consider contact the company that installed your double glazing, as they might be able assist in resolving any issues that you might encounter with it. If you choose to make a replacement, it's worth considering upgrading to a glass unit that is A-rated since this will increase the energy efficiency of your home and save you money on your energy bills.
